American Airlines issued a statement disagreeing with a StellaService survey that put AA hold times in last place during Hurricane Irene. During the eight calls placed by the survey team, the average hold time they experienced was 1 hour and 32 minutes, while American Airlines says its internal metrics showed an average hold time of 21 minutes. Said the company, "We disagree with the findings of the study. We believe it is highly inaccurate and based on an insufficient sample size -- eight calls and 12 tweets on average -- that skewed results and does not represent reality."
